WEF 2022: Prepare for future headwinds as tourism sector shows recovery

The growth in international tourist arrivals in January 2022 over January 2021 is greater than arrivals growth in all of 2021, the report said

After being hit by the Covid-19 pandemic for two years, the tourism sector is showing signs of recovery in many parts of the world, with the US, Japan, Spain, France and Germany at the top.

India, meanwhile, ranked at the 54th place in an index, down from 46th in 2019, but still remained on the top within South Asia.

Released by the World Economic Forum (WEF) on Tuesday, The Travel & Tourism Development Index 2021: Rebuilding for a Sustainable and Resilient Future, raned 117 economies on a range of factors that are crucial to the development, sustainability and resiliency
